Exactly How to Strategy Your Visit
Preparation your browse through to the Semenggoh Orangutan Centre calls for mindful consideration to make certain an improving experience. Begin by examining the centre's official site for the most recent information on operating hours and any kind of seasonal variations that might influence your check out. The most effective time to observe orangutans is during their feeding sessions, generally held twice daily at 9:00 AM and 3:00 PM.
Transportation alternatives consist of local taxis, ride-sharing services, or guided excursions, which frequently provide hassle-free plans. It is suggested to get to least half an hour early to protect a great viewing spot and delight in the bordering jungle.
Think about putting on comfy garments and durable footwear, as the surface can be irregular and humid. Bring a recyclable water container and bug spray to stay protected and moisturized. Photography is urged, but remember to avoid and keep a respectful range flash photography to ensure the health of the orangutans.
